6. Object manager
6.3.7 Device types
When a new, unknown instrument model should be calibrated, it can be generated
beforehand. For this instrument, information such as name, measurement parameter,
manufacturer, type of instrument and possible accuracies are dened and stored with
[Add].
Instrument models can be created for standards, calibration items, multimeters and
even shunts. There can, for example, be two standards on the instrument model
“CPC8000”. The dierent CPC8000 standards can thus have only predened
accuracies. This has the advantage that when you create the calibration certicate, only
the predened accuracies for that model can be selected. If only one accuracy is added,
it is automatically pre-selected and does not need an additional click every time.
